Significant differences between tuna Bluefin and lima beans

  • Tuna Bluefin has more vitamin B12, selenium, vitamin B3, vitamin A, phosphorus, vitamin B6, and vitamin B2; however, lima beans are richer in fiber, manganese, and folate.
  • Tuna Bluefin covers your daily vitamin B12 needs 453% more than lima beans.
  • Lima beans have a higher glycemic index. The glycemic index of lima beans is 32, while the glycemic index of tuna Bluefin is 0.

Specific food types used in this comparison are Fish, tuna, fresh, bluefin, cooked, dry heat and Lima beans, large, mature seeds, cooked, boiled, without salt.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Tuna Bluefin Lima beans DV% diff.
Vitamin B12 10.88µg 0µg 453%
Vitamin A 757µg 0µg 84%
Selenium 46.8µg 4.5µg 77%
Vitamin B3 10.54mg 0.421mg 63%
Protein 29.91g 7.8g 44%
Phosphorus 326mg 111mg 31%
Fiber 0g 7g 28%
Vitamin B6 0.525mg 0.161mg 28%
Manganese 0.02mg 0.516mg 22%
Folate 2µg 83µg 20%
Vitamin B2 0.306mg 0.055mg 19%
Vitamin B5 1.37mg 0.422mg 19%
Cholesterol 49mg 0mg 16%
Iron 1.31mg 2.39mg 14%
Copper 0.11mg 0.235mg 14%
Polyunsaturated fat 1.844g 0.171g 11%
Vitamin B1 0.278mg 0.161mg 10%
Fats 6.28g 0.38g 9%
Saturated fat 1.612g 0.089g 7%
Carbs 0g 20.88g 7%
Choline 32.5mg 6%
Potassium 323mg 508mg 5%
Monounsaturated fat 2.053g 0.034g 5%
Magnesium 64mg 43mg 5%
Calories 184kcal 115kcal 3%
Vitamin K 2µg 2%
Sodium 50mg 2mg 2%
Zinc 0.77mg 0.95mg 2%
Vitamin E 0.18mg 1%
Calcium 10mg 17mg 1%
